Nepali Congress delegation meets EAM Jaishankar, BJP chief Nadda
New Delhi, Oct 8 (UNI) A three-member Nepali Congress delegation on Friday met External Affairs Minister S Jaishankar and also BJP president JP Nadda.
Jaishankar tweeted on the meeting: “Pleased to welcome Nepali Congress delegation visiting India at the invitation of @BJP4India
“Appreciate the discussion with Shri Prakash Mahatji and delegation.”
Prakash S. Mahat, former Nepal Minister for Foreign Affairs, Joint General Secretary, Nepali Congress Party, in a tweet said: “At the invitation of BJP, a delegation of Nepali Congress under my leadership is in New Delhi.
“Met BJP president JP Nadda and had good discussion on expanding exchanges and sharing good practices between two parties.
“Also discussed issues of importance to Nepal and India.”
The delegation also includes Udaya Shumsher Rana and Ajaya Kumar Chaurasiya.
The delegation is visiting India at the invitation of Vijay Chauthaiwale, the BJP’s Foreign Affairs Department head.
